North American Free Trade Agreement is a treaty entered by the United States, Canada and Mexico which came into effect on January 1,1994 it was sign by President Clinton, it was the largest free trade agreement in the world. It goal was to reduce trading cost, increase business investment and help North America be more competitive in the global market, and it was created as a response to trade competition posed by China and the EU.

According to the testimony given to the Congress ,North American Free Trade Agreement(NAFTA) skeptics cite the loss of United States manufacturing jobs as a reason to criticize. This skeptics cited was right because according to CFR, the United States auto sector actually lost roughly 350000 jobs between 1994 and 2016 and many of the job lose were taken up by worker in mexico.
